Why Choose Aluminium Windows?
Before diving into the function of the installer, it's important to understand why property owners are deciding for aluminium windows. Here are some compelling reasons:
1. Sturdiness
Aluminium is naturally resistant to corrosion, rust, and warping. This durability makes it a perfect choice for numerous climate condition.
2. Low Maintenance
Unlike wood, which needs routine painting and sealing, aluminium needs very little maintenance, generally simply a simple cleaning with soap and water.
3. Aesthetic Appeal
Aluminium windows come in numerous designs and colors, permitting property owners to pick styles that complement their homes.
4. Energy Efficiency
With developments in thermal break innovation, aluminium windows can use exceptional insulation, contributing to decreased energy bills.
5. Security
Aluminium windows are robust and can be boosted with sophisticated locking systems, providing added safety for homes.

The Role of an Aluminium Window Installer
An aluminium window installer is accountable for the proper installation of aluminium windows in residential properties. Their duties extend beyond simply fitting the windows; they ensure that the installation is smooth, protected, and energy-efficient. Here are crucial elements of their function:
1. Assessment and Planning
Before the installation begins, the installer talks to the homeowner to understand their choices, spending plan, and the particular requirements of the job. This preparation stage is crucial for figuring out the best type and size of windows.
2. Measurement and Assessment
Accurate measurements are essential for a successful installation. The installer determines the window openings to make sure that the new aluminium windows fit perfectly. Windows And Doors R Us might also examine existing structures to recognize any issues that require resolving, such as rot or structural weaknesses.
3. Installation Process
The installation includes several actions, including:
- Preparation: Removing old windows and preparing the opening.
- Fitting: Positioning the new windows precisely.
- Sealing: Ensuring correct sealing to prevent drafts and water intrusion.
- Finishing: Adding trims and guaranteeing everything runs properly.
4. Post-Installation Inspection
After installation, the installer checks the windows for appropriate operation. They make sure there are no spaces, leaks, or misalignments which the windows open and close efficiently.
5. Education and Maintenance Advice
A professional installer offers important info on maintaining aluminium windows. This guidance is crucial for extending the life of the windows and guaranteeing optimal efficiency.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How long does it take to set up aluminium windows?
A1: The period of the installation depends on the variety of windows being installed and the complexity of the job. Normally, it can take anywhere from a few hours to a couple of days.
Q2: Can I set up aluminium windows myself?
A2: While it is possible, it is not suggested due to the intricacies included. Working with a professional makes sure proper installation and adherence to building guidelines.
Q3: What is the cost of setting up aluminium windows?
A3: Costs can vary substantially based upon window size, style, and the installer's rates. On average, property owners can anticipate to pay between ₤ 500 and ₤ 1,500 per window.
Q4: How do I maintain aluminium windows?
A4: Maintenance is simple. Regular cleansing with moderate soap and water, examining seals for wear, and checking for any blockages will be adequate.
Q5: Do aluminium windows feature a service warranty?
A5: Yes, a lot of makers offer warranties on their products, which can differ in length and coverage. Always examine the service warranty information before acquiring.
